C# Класс CorsairLinkPlusPlus.RESTAPI.RequestHandler

Показать файл Открыть проект

Открытые методы

Метод Описание
RequestHandler ( ITcpChannel channel, Griffin.Net.Protocols.Http.HttpRequestBase request ) : CorsairLinkPlusPlus.Common
Start ( ) : void

Приватные методы

Метод Описание
GetCurrentUser ( string auth ) : UserData?
RespondWithDevice ( IDevice device ) : bool
RespondWithJSON ( object result, bool success = true, int statusCode = 200, string>.Dictionary headers = null ) : bool
RespondWithRaw ( Stream body, int statusCode, string mimeType, string>.Dictionary headers = null ) : bool
_Start ( ) : void

Описание методов

RequestHandler() публичный Метод

public RequestHandler ( ITcpChannel channel, Griffin.Net.Protocols.Http.HttpRequestBase request ) : CorsairLinkPlusPlus.Common
channel ITcpChannel
request Griffin.Net.Protocols.Http.HttpRequestBase
Результат CorsairLinkPlusPlus.Common

Start() публичный Метод

public Start ( ) : void
Результат void